  • According to the 1838 Black Metropolis, William Still’s Vigilance Committee kept records of hundreds of freed slaves- including his long-lost brother- who sought refuge at their headquarters at 5th & Vine in Philadelphia’s Old City. Still’s heroic efforts to help freedom seekers begin new lives has led him to be known as the Father of the Underground Railroad.
